Family solicitors Solihull – cohabitation matters

For cohabiting couples, navigating legal issues can be particularly challenging, as the legal rights and obligations of unmarried partners differ from those of married couples. Our solicitors have the knowledge and experience to assist cohabiting couples in matters such as property rights and financial agreements.
